Uncharted lake Synonyms

Definitions for Uncharted


  • (adjective) (of unknown regions) not yet surveyed or investigated

Definitions for Lake


  • (noun) a body of (usually fresh) water surrounded by land
  • (noun) any of numerous bright translucent organic pigments
  • (noun) a purplish red pigment prepared from lac or cochineal